Once again, Panasonic is playing the “mine’s bigger than yours” game, and we have to admit we’re jealous. While we’re “coping” with a 32-inch HD Ready TV we’ll be reviewing for you shortly [Oh, the horrors we go through for you], Panasonic is busy waving its 150-inch monster in our faces.
During the Consumer Electronics Show in Las Vegas the company unveiled a variety of products, including a 150-inch plasma HDTV. And just in case you’re about to get the tape measure out and head into the living room, that makes it the largest on the market – and officially bigger than yours. The consumer electronics manufacturer also found time to drag its eyes away from the massive shiny box to debut an ultra-thin 50-inch plasma TV and a portable digital video recorder (DVR). Hopefully, we won’t have TV envy too long, though. After all, Sharp reckons we’ll all be watching 60-inch TVs pretty soon.
